How to Make Japanese Soup with Bone Broth

Set a saucepan over medium heat.

Then add some vegetable oil along with 8 ounces of sliced portobello mushrooms.

Season with kosher salt and pepper.

Cook the mushrooms for a few minutes, stirring a few times.

After 4 to 5 minutes, add some ginger paste or minced ginger.

And cook for another minute.

Next pour 32 ounces of bone broth in with the mushrooms.

You can use store bought or make your own.

Bone broth has some great health benefits such as weight loss, great for your skin, helps with digestive issues, and supports your immune system.

It tastes like regular broth, just with more of a rich flavor in my opinion.

Also add 2 tablespoons soy sauce and some sliced green onions or chives.

Bring this to a boil, reduce the heat to medium low and let it simmer for a few minutes.

Japanese Soup with Bone Broth

Japanese Soup with Bone Broth is like the clear soup that you get at hibachi restaurants, but this one is super healthy made with bone broth

Course Soup
Cuisine American, Japanese
Keyword Bone Broth, Easy, French Onion, Healthy, Japanese, Mushroom, Recipe, Soup
Prep Time 10 minutes
Cook Time 10 minutes
Servings 6
Calories 79 kcal
Author Cheri Renee

Ingredients

  • 1 Tbsp vegetable oil
  • 8 oz sliced baby portobello mushrooms
  • kosher salt, pepper
  • 1 Tbsp ginger paste or grated ginger
  • 32 oz box bone broth (beef, chicken, or vegetable)
  • 2 Tbsps soy sauce
  • 1/4 cup sliced green onions or chives
  • 1 cup french fried onions

Instructions

  1. Set a saucepan over medium heat. Once hot add the oil and the mushrooms, kosher salt, and pepper. Cook 4 to 5 minutes, stirring a few times.

  2. Add the ginger and cook 1 more minute.

  3. Add the bone broth, soy sauce, and green onions or chives. Bring to a boil and reduce the heat to simmer for a few minutes.

  4. Right before serving, stir in the french fried onions.
